Clinical Application

Fine narrow 1x2-tooth tissue forceps are intended for precise, controlled handling of delicate soft tissues where minimal crushing and accurate placement are required. The 1x2 tooth tip provides a secure purchase with reduced slip, making these forceps appropriate for wound edge approximation, atraumatic tissue retraction, mucosal handling, and fine dissection in confined fields. Common clinical settings include general surgery, ENT, plastic and reconstructive procedures, minor vascular work, and other procedures that demand delicate tissue manipulation.

Design & Configuration

The narrow, tweezer-style geometry gives enhanced visibility and access in tight surgical sites and small incisions. The 1x2 tooth arrangement (one tooth on one jaw opposing two on the other) concentrates gripping force at discrete contact points to secure tissue with minimal surface trauma. The thumb-operated spring action provides direct tactile feedback and fine control over grip pressure, enabling precise positioning during suturing, trimming, or tissue repositioning.

Material & Construction

Manufactured from surgical-grade stainless steel with precision-formed tips to ensure consistent alignment and reliable engagement of the 1x2 tooth configuration. Mirror-polished surfaces resist corrosion and are compatible with standard reprocessing protocols. The instrument is designed for repeated use and routine sterilization according to facility procedures.
